Window damage can be caused by shifting foundations A foundation that is settling could cause a variety of issues, such as stuck windows. To determine whether your foundation is damaged, call a foundation specialist. A foundation that is moving can also cause other problems such as uneven floors and broken utility pipes. One of the best ways to know whether your foundation is settling is to look at the concrete walls from inside of your basement. If your foundation is in good order and the walls appear level and smooth. If you notice cracks on the walls or a crack under a window, it might have foundation issues. Cracks in walls near doors are another sign of a settled foundation. This is particularly true for older homes. This is due to the earth around your home expanding and expanding as humidity and moisture levels change. A hairline crack in the wall may be a sign of a settling foundation. It may not be the most obvious indication of a foundation that is shifting however it is a sign of trouble. Another indication that your foundation might have issues is when your windows and doors are difficult to open or close. The door or window could be dragging or misaligned. The foundation could shift, and your doors or windows may not align properly and cause issues that could cause them to stick. You may also notice a crack in the wall, such as cracks in the foundation or a stairstep crack in the brick. These are all indications of a foundation which is not properly settling. A foundation that is settling is not always an ideal idea. However, it can be fixed quickly. A qualified foundation repair expert can elevate your foundation to its original location and seal cracks in walls. A foundation repair expert is a great option to save money on future repairs. If you have a settling foundation and have problems with your windows and doors It's time to contact an expert in foundation repair. Double-pane window repairs If you're seeking to improve your home's energy efficiency, or want to create a fresh look for your home double pane windows are an option to consider. They are more energy efficient than single pane windows and offer better insulation, noise control and a higher efficiency in energy use. They are also sturdy and reliable. Double pane windows consist of two glass pieces which are separated by a spacer made from metal. The air pocket in between the panes reduces thermal transfer and increases insulation. Double pane windows are typically used in new construction homes. They are susceptible to breaking and need to be replaced.
